Localization explore of electrical and I and C equipments in Daya Bay Nuclear Power Station

The supply of electronic instrumentation and controlling (I and C) equipments in Daya Bay Nuclear Power Station depends on importation up to now, however, reliable supply of spare parts is presently threatened by many factors. Consequently, Daya Bay Nuclear Power Station tries to localize these equipments. According to a survey, China has possessed the ability to undertake the research, development and production of the I and C system in nuclear power independently. We propose that localization should firstly starts with the production of replacement board and parts for analogical I and C system, gradually leads to the substitution of system cabinet units, and finally realize the independent research, development and production of advanced digital main control system. A series of prominent problems of producing nuclear grade I and C equipments are focused on the designing, manufacturing, testing and reliability evaluation. In this paper, technical procedures, regulations, standards and management experiences related to the localization of nuclear power electrical and I and C are introduced. (authors)
